I have the Linksys G router with "speed booster", and get 54 Mbps routinely. I got it to replace a 802.11b router that was just too slow anymore. I considered getting the SRX, but couldn't justify the nearly triple price. I figure another year or two we will have N spec'ed routers out, and by then I will replace my laptop.

Quote:
Originally Posted by Boatrider
As a MCSE and A Network Engineer, with 10 years of network experience. You can't do much better than the WRT54GX. It' s kick ass fast.
Unless you have VoIP in your house. QoS (802.11E) is broken on every one of those new SRX models except the v1 that came out a while a go. I just tried the new SRX400 and QoS is still broken. VoIP lines just get a fast busy signal when trying to dial. Linksys is aware,, and still released it broken. That one is going back and have the new Netgear RangeMax 240 on order. Even with legacy B/G equipment you get much better range with the MIMO technology, just not the speed unless you pair it with one of the vendor specific cards.
